Dreaming of school
sukuu Twi
AmbivalentPlaces
Learning, evaluation and unfinished formation.
Akan · traditional✓ reviewed
School stands for formation and for the hopes a family invests in a person. Returning there is often read as a lesson not yet completed, or an expectation still being carried.
Biblical✓ reviewed
Instruction and discipline in scripture are the marks of care, not rejection. The dream is read as a season of being taught something you will need.
Qur’anic · Ibn Sīrīn✓ reviewed
Seeking knowledge holds high standing in the tradition, and study imagery is generally read favourably as growth in understanding.
Psychological✓ reviewed
School settings signal ongoing self-evaluation and areas where you feel you have not yet mastered something.
Secular · sleep science✓ reviewed
School dreams persist lifelong and appear during periods of learning or assessment at work, one of the most durable dream settings recorded.
